Every phase ends with a phase-end display showing:
Phase duration or distance
Heart rate difference (how much you have increased or decreased your heart rate
during the phase) or average speed
Average heart rate
Number of ended phase
Once a programmed exercise is over, this display shows that the exercise is
completed,
The cycling computer enters Free exercise mode, and you can continue exercising
without settings. The exercise is recorded and filed.

Functions During Exercise

Change the same settings in a programmed exercise as with any other exercise type. For further
information on different functions during exercise, see Button Functions (page 21).
The programmed exercise uses the sport profile settings set in the Polar ProTrainer 5 software. If you
change the cycling computer settings during exercise (e.g. HR view), the changes will only apply to the
current exercise. Next time you start the same exercise, the cycling computer will use the sport profile
settings defined in the software.

Lap Menu

To see the lap menu during programmed exercise, press and hold
DOWN and select with OK. The contents of the lap menu depend on your exercise.
• End phase: End current phase and move to the next phase in the exercise.
• Jump to: Move to any other phase in your exercise.
